Minecraft-Launcher: Remove the useless ebuild and create another one

This commit is contained in:
TheDevKiller 2019-05-04 21:47:56 +02:00
parent 202a0f33b6
commit 5e2b6cb37a
4 changed files with 26 additions and 44 deletions

View File

@ -0,0 +1,2 @@
DIST Minecraft.tar.gz 58188591 BLAKE2B 3a76fdc4bc630472ce945cbc2e6a81804f35c77d1e92d102b88a534df3dc93f71a5f848ca2a826d708ab5fe807d84eaa3593eb8ba46f7de86afce3d4a907d3c5 SHA512 e52d04a31bbe898dc4db464e323da6a949aaa83498f7f3866c43c74397db1b561f6a98c2f68498862739b86b0e264106239ecb7f9fedda416919322671dbbbfe
EBUILD minecraft-launcher-9999.ebuild 532 BLAKE2B 4ce977b744b71c71ebd9ae64518bc55997fb1c6bda5d55c0febb23a95f294943777b4961d01dc26dd45e0448ddbe9705d08335251136923028bcd35f5cf976c7 SHA512 9c37ca6e64f0052c6f558e85c7b55499c02c48b6a033ff5090229b3b00a6cf168b227015acd83eaa4c4b22a54076a088062a9b4f428f67488691af393115f9f6

View File

@ -0,0 +1,24 @@
# Copyright 2019 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
DESCRIPTION="The official Minecraft launcher"
HOMEPAGE="https://www.minecraft.net/fr-fr/download/alternative/"
SRC_URI="https://launcher.mojang.com/download/Minecraft.tar.gz"
LICENSE=""
S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E=""
DEPEND="~virtual/java-1.8.0"
RDEPEND="${DEPEND}"
BDEPEND=""
src_install() {
dodir "/usr/share/${P}"
insinto "/usr/share/${P}"
doins .*
dosym /usr/bin/${P} /usr/share/${P}/minecraft-launcher
}

View File

@ -1,3 +0,0 @@
DIST minecraft-launcher-1.6.91.jar.lzma 3898657 BLAKE2B 5c547f5132facd301ad0d388cc77148c4bc16ec69c892788361a3e4b471931efe25a41c3f2f72216942983f90f6454f55ebcb96d9e74a310831d8374f94aba0b SHA512 9eb81c0f6ae84403660cb040af75a0aa0c4f6e1af6c0ca37c37075c96b8a9ed26241ce682d94e0efb10d32a660ad9eb726d5f79f764c3b16005c2156e98f108e
DIST minecraft.png 27633 BLAKE2B 6e718ae403eba36269704de8a488a8bbd82c733537c316a4b20a2b7f07733c266cadcec9d4636bda13c80a5eb155028e998c792b97978102d39c31de3ec7eaa0 SHA512 394450f1f2fdd966bd698265d4b543a20f197e8a096c9aeebcc610d3cef73de8493b00f078a1bb50d24230535ffa0537ded95cd38e913130268f053c44f3524a
EBUILD minecraft-1.6.91.ebuild 1007 BLAKE2B 095d3d812844dddc09382fbb417c36140aaa28f71ea445ab82b53e8c74a1c4d5f88ee063a65bc5e839c6e4054a566045b7971408021f9c2d34dec8ec55479bdd SHA512 b663c988d93effa3458c9017c180d056b2fe73a2954779917743245a503361165b51cc2ed20d41d40344ee6cf7ad2a75ca05717098b06deae22f67ee90f6f311

View File

@ -1,41 +0,0 @@
# Copyright 1999-2018 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
inherit desktop
MY_JAR="${PN}-launcher-${PV}.jar"
DESCRIPTION="Official Java launcher for Minecraft"
HOMEPAGE="https://minecraft.net"
SRC_URI="http://launcher.mojang.com/mc/launcher/jar/fa896bd4c79d4e9f0d18df43151b549f865a3db6/launcher.jar.lzma -> ${MY_JAR}.lzma
https://minecraft.net/android-icon-192x192.png -> minecraft.png"
LICENSE="Minecraft-clickwrap-EULA"
S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E=""
DEPEND=""
RDEPEND="${DEPEND}
media-libs/openal
virtual/opengl
virtual/jre"
S="${WORKDIR}"
src_install() {
dobin "${FILESDIR}"/minecraft
doicon -s 192 "${DISTDIR}"/minecraft.png
insinto /usr/share/games/"${PN}"
newins "${MY_JAR}" launcher.jar
make_desktop_entry minecraft Minecraft minecraft
}
pkg_postinst() {
einfo "This package has installed the Java Minecraft launcher."
einfo "To actually play the game, you need to purchase an account at:"
einfo " ${HOMEPAGE}"
}